Ebay airbag?
Hi All,
I'm looking to upgrade my 991.1 multi steering wheel to a 991.2 wheel.
I just purchased the wheel, and will be purchasing the module soon. I just found a few airbags on Ebay, but being a safety item and with old Takata airbags potentially being out there, I was curious if there was any way to look at serial numbers or manufacture dates to see if they were ok?
Anyone with any insight or first hand experience with this?

If you got it from a dismantler like DC autmotive or Ladismantler you could run the VIN number of the donor car against the NHSTA database for recalls.

I've done the mod. Bought both the steering wheel and the airbag on eBay from two different sellers. Both units had Porsche part numbers and installed as the stock parts should. Porsche NEVER used Takata for their airbags!

I got my wheel from Sunset & airbag from Ebay. The first airbag I got was the correct style, but had the wrong connectors... they were yellow & teal, instead of yellow & brown. Seller tried to talk to me into modifying the teal connector... I declined & he sent me a different airbag with the correct connectors after a little waiting.

Don't order a used airbag.. Did the swap on a '13 C4S and they sent a macan airbag with a plastic textured finish.. It plugged right in sat inside the steering wheel but there was a noticeable gap around the perimeter of the airbag.
Ended up ordering a new airbag off suncoast. worked well.

I'm not sure why there was a noticeable gap between the new 991.2 wheel and airbag.. You could see around the edge of the airbag and through into the steering wheel.
Be weary, the ebay sellers will list the item as a 911 part but it could be from something else which is what happened.
Suncoast sent the proper leather airbag but it was on back order for quite a while.
